How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West End Providence?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| West End Providence Studio Apartments | $2,405 | $1,600 | $4,438 |
| West End Providence 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,931 | $899 | $4,566 |
| West End Providence 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,167 | $1,600 | $3,200 |
| West End Providence 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,259 | $1,900 | $2,750 |
| West End Providence 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,075 | $2,450 | $4,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about West End Providence
What is the current price range for One Bedroom West End Providence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in West End Providence ranges from $899 to $4,566 with an average monthly rent of $1,931.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in West End Providence c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in West End Providence range from $1,600 to $3,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,167.
How expensive are West End Providence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 104 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in West End Providence on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,900 to $2,750 - averaging $2,259 for the location.
